Quick Guide to ASTM D-4956 Sign Sheeting Types and Adhesive Backing Classes – 

There are nine types and five classes of retroreflective sheeting.

Types are determined by conformance to the retro-reflectance, color, and durability requirements (as listed in the standard) and may be of any construction providing that those requirements are met. Common references for each type of retro-reflective sheeting are:

Retro Reflective Sheeting Types (ASTM D-4956) –

(Note – For comparison, candela ratings are based on a .2 observation angle/-4 entrance angle)

  • Type I – Engineering Grade (Glass Bead Technology) (75 Candelas for White)

  • Type II – Super engineer grade (Glass Bead Technology) (140 Candelas for White)

  • Type III – High-intensity Glass Bead (Glass Bead Technology) (250 Candelas for White)

  • Type IV – High-intensity Micro-Prismatic (360 Candelas for White)

  • Type V – Super High Intensity Sheeting for Delineators (typically a thin metalized film – rugged and incredibly bright) (700 Candelas for White – up to 2000 Candelas for .1/-4 observation)

  • Type VI – Elastomeric retroreflective sheeting without adhesive – Roll up Sign Material (160 Candelas for Pink)
  • Type VII – Discontinued and Replaced by Type 8 Sheeting.

  • Type VIII – Retroreflective sheeting typically manufactured as an unmetalized cube corner Micro-Prismatic retroreflective element material. (700 Candelas for White) 
  • Type IX – Retroreflective sheeting typically manufactured as an unmetalized cube corner Micro-Prismatic retroreflective element material. (380 Candelas for White)
  • Type X – Discontinued and Replaced by Type 8 Sheeting. 
  • Type XI—Retroreflective sheeting typically manufactured as an unmetalized cube corner Micro-Prismatic retroreflective element material. (580 Candelas for White)

Adhesive backing classes –

  • Class 1 – Pressure-sensitive adhesive (no heat or solvent) – most common

  • Class 2 – Adhesive activated by heat and pressure
  • Class 3 – Repositionable low-tack pressure-sensitive adhesive 
  • Class 4 – Low-temperature (-7°C) pressure-sensitive adhesive
  • Class 5 – Non-adhesive backing (i.e. roll up signs)
